Massive hike in user fee at Delhi and Mumbai Airports


Massive hike in user fee at Delhi and Mumbai Airports

A massive increase in user fees at major Indian hubs has left passengers surprised, especially at Delhi Airports and Mumbai’s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j International Airport. These new charges are now affecting almost every traveler, whether flying domestic or international.

Why the Fee Hike Matters

User fees may sound like a minor expense, but when they increase sharply, the impact hits every wallet. Whether someone is flying for business, tourism, or family reasons, this extra cost adds up quickly.

What Led to the Sudden Increase?

Financial Recovery Post-Pandemic

Airports suffered major financial losses during COVID-19. With passenger traffic dropping drastically, airports struggled to maintain operations. The recent fee hike is partly an effort to recover from that setback.

Expansion and Infrastructure Development

Delhi and Mumbai airports are modernizing rapidly. From new terminals to upgraded runways, these projects require huge investment. Authorities claim the higher fees will support ongoing and future upgrades.

Impact on Passengers

Higher Travel Costs

The direct impact is simple: flight tickets become more expensive. Since airlines include user fees within fare breakdowns, passengers must bear the cost.

No Significant Benefit for Flyers

Even though fees are rising, passengers often don’t see immediate improvements in service. Long queues, delays, and limited seating remain common complaints.

Impact on Airlines

Operational Budget Pressure

Airlines already operate on thin profits. With higher airport charges, they may be forced to increase fares or cut operational costs.
